: Most Jiu jitsu know that the of off balancing an opponent is referred to as “kuzushi” in Japanese. Most also realize the importance of this to set up on the feet and also from bottom position on the ground. That's all fine as a theory – but what about practice? How do you know you've done a good job of off balancing an opponent in the heat of sparring or competition to a degree that it will be useful for your ? When working from bottom guard position the single clearest sign is – DID YOU MAKE YOUR TOUCH THE MAT? If the answer is yes – well done – he is definitely out of and you are ready to attack. When working your kuzushi on your opponent just try to involuntarily touch his hand to the mat and then immediately attack. Learn to do it and learn to recognize it as an important sign and your effectiveness from guard will greatly increase
